Biography

Ellis Clugston (SN 851) born at Warracknabeal, was an 18 year old labourer when he enlisted in Ballarat on March 29th 1915. On May 8th he embarked from Melbourne aboard the Euripides and sailed to Egypt where he joined the 24th Infantry Battalion. In October he was admitted to hospital in Cairo suffering from diphtheria and for a time he was listed as dangerously ill. Due to ‘muscular wasting’ he was returned to Australia aboard the Ulysses. He reached Melbourne on February 5th 1916 and was discharged medically unfit on July 12th.

His brother Henry also served in the AIF and is honoured with a tree in the Avenue.
